In liver cells, glycogen phosphorylase acts in which of the three stages of the signaling pathway associated with an epinephrine
goldenfox [79]

Answer:

The second stage.

Explanation:

Epinephrine is a hormone that is released by the glands over the kidneys that initiate a fight-or-flight response sequence in the body which starts with the segregation of the hormone and ends with the release of glucose into the bloodstream by the liver to provide energy required for the situation by the body.

The liver cells acts in the second stage of the epinephrine initiated signal with glycogen phosphorylase enzyme. The released epinephrine activates an enzyme called phosphorylase kinase and that in turn activates glycogen phosphorylase. Lastly glycogen phosphorylase reacts to epinephrine and releases another enzyme to remove the phospate from the glycogen phosphorylase group to form glucose that will be released into the bloodstream for energy.

An individual with a protein deficiency typically experiences increased susceptibility to illnesses, muscle and joint pain, and
natima [27]

Answer is option A.

A protein deficiency causes such diverse symptoms because immune, nervous, and muscle system cells require proteins for structure and regulation.

Proteins are the building blocks of bones, muscles, cartilage, skin, and blood. They also help in  transporting oxygen, helps in blood clotting during injuries etc.

In addition to phospholipids, which of the following organic molecules are also a part of cellular membranes?
laiz [17]
The 2 major components or parts that compose or make up the plasma membrane of a eukaryotic cell would be the phospholipids arranged as a bilayer, having phospholipids arranged side by side in an upright and inverted manner, allowing for the hydrophobic and hydrophilic regions to interact respectively, and also Protein molecules, more specifically Transmembrane Proteins and Integral Proteins.
